Long Term Drug and Alcohol Treatment and Psychological Care in Alpharetta, Georgia

Upon completion of a long-term alcohol and drug drug and alcohol addiction program in Alpharetta, you may still be required to continue with your treatment. However, some people may start wondering why they would be required to spend so long in such a center.

For example they may imagine that it would be more useful to finish short-term rehab before enrolling in an intensive outpatient facility. Still, even though some addicted individuals have found sobriety through this type of rehab, there are individuals who would benefit more by spending a number of months in an inpatient facility. These include addicted individuals with weak recovery skills as well as those who might require extra assistance and support to overcome their drug addiction.

These addicts include those who:

  • Are utterly unable to structure their lives without abusing their drugs of choice
  • Come from unsafe areas and homes that could tempt them to begin using again
  • Have co-occurring psychological conditions
  • Start using harmful and mind-altering substances from a young age
  • Completed drug addiction rehabilitation but relapse to their old using patterns

In many instances, long term drug rehab might also be accompanied by extended care and psychological rehabilitation. This is because the mental illnesses often co-occur with addiction - by leading people to abuse drugs or arising from drug and alcohol abuse - often require long term management and treatment.

Through an Alpharetta, GA. long-term facility, therefore, you will get all the care and help you need to overcome both your drug and alcohol abuse and any co-occurring mental health disorder that you are suffering from.

If you choose short-term treatment, you may discover that you increasingly isolate yourself, neglect your health and wellness, and stop taking the medications that doctors recommended to you. This is why long-term drug and alcohol rehabilitation makes sense for individuals with co-occurring disorders and who need more intensive care.
